My Christmas Tree Edging Pattern is worked in two colours. At one point, the ring needs to be the same colour as the chain so the shoe-lace trick (SLT) is used. Here is a video that shows how I make the SLT so that there is no blip of colour.

Using the SLT does cause a bit of twisting in the tatting which wouldn't otherwise be there but it's a compromise for the flexibility of using colours where you want them.
